Design and Display: A Visual Treat
The Redmi Note 8 Pro boasts a premium design with a glass back and a gradient finish, making it visually appealing. It feels solid in hand, although the glass construction can be a bit slippery. The phone is available in several color options, allowing users to choose one that suits their personal style. The build quality is commendable, giving the device a flagship-like feel.
The display is a 6.53-inch IPS LCD panel with a resolution of 2340 x 1080 pixels (Full HD+). The screen offers vibrant colors, good contrast, and decent viewing angles. The brightness is sufficient for outdoor use, although direct sunlight might pose a challenge. The display is protected by Corning Gorilla Glass 5, which provides resistance against scratches and minor impacts. This makes the device more durable for everyday use. - Screen Size: 6.53 inches
- Resolution: 2340 x 1080 pixels (Full HD+)
- Panel Type: IPS LCD
- Protection: Corning Gorilla Glass 5
Performance: Power Under the Hood
One of the standout characteristics of the Xiaomi Redmi Note 8 Pro is its performance. It is powered by the MediaTek Helio G90T processor, an octa-core chipset designed for gaming. This processor is paired with up to 8GB of RAM, ensuring smooth multitasking and responsiveness. The phone handles demanding games and applications with ease, making it a great choice for gamers and power users. The Helio G90T also features a liquid cooling system, which helps to prevent overheating during prolonged gaming sessions.
The Redmi Note 8 Pro also offers ample storage space, with options ranging from 64GB to 128GB. The storage can be further expanded via a microSD card, allowing users to store even more photos, videos, and files. The combination of a powerful processor, ample RAM, and expandable storage makes the Redmi Note 8 Pro a capable and versatile device.
- Processor: MediaTek Helio G90T
- RAM: Up to 8GB
- Storage: 64GB/128GB
- Expandable Storage: Yes, via microSD card
Camera: Capturing Moments in Detail
The camera system is another highlight of the Redmi Note 8 Pro. It features a quad-camera setup on the rear, headlined by a 64-megapixel primary sensor. This sensor captures detailed and sharp images in well-lit conditions. The other cameras include an 8-megapixel ultrawide lens, a 2-megapixel macro lens, and a 2-megapixel depth sensor. The ultrawide lens allows users to capture expansive landscapes, while the macro lens enables close-up shots of small objects. The depth sensor helps to create a bokeh effect in portrait mode.
The Redmi Note 8 Pro also excels in low-light photography. The camera utilizes pixel binning technology to combine four pixels into one, resulting in brighter and clearer images. The phone also features a dedicated night mode, which further enhances low-light performance. The 20-megapixel front-facing camera captures detailed selfies and supports features like AI beautification and portrait mode. The phone can also record videos at up to 4K resolution, offering good video quality.
- Rear Camera: 64MP (primary) + 8MP (ultrawide) + 2MP (macro) + 2MP (depth)
- Front Camera: 20MP
- Video Recording: Up to 4K resolution
- Features: Night mode, AI beautification, Portrait mode
Battery Life: Powering Through the Day
The Redmi Note 8 Pro is equipped with a 4500mAh battery, which provides excellent battery life. The phone can easily last a full day on a single charge, even with heavy usage. The device also supports 18W fast charging, allowing users to quickly top up the battery. The combination of a large battery and fast charging makes the Redmi Note 8 Pro a reliable device for users who are always on the go. The long-lasting battery ensures that users can enjoy their favorite games, movies, and applications without worrying about running out of power.
The phone also features power-saving modes, which can further extend battery life. These modes restrict background activity and reduce screen brightness to conserve power. Users can also customize these modes to suit their individual needs. The Redmi Note 8 Pro’s battery performance is one of its strongest selling points.
- Battery Capacity: 4500mAh
- Charging: 18W Fast Charging
- Battery Life: Full day on a single charge (typical usage)
- Power Saving Modes: Yes
Software and Features: MIUI Experience
The Redmi Note 8 Pro runs on Xiaomi’s MIUI operating system, which is based on Android. MIUI offers a highly customizable and feature-rich experience. It includes a variety of pre-installed applications and tools, as well as a range of customization options. While some users appreciate the added features, others find MIUI to be a bit bloated. The software is generally smooth and responsive, but occasional lags and stutters can occur.
Xiaomi regularly releases updates for MIUI, which include bug fixes, performance improvements, and new features. The company also provides timely security updates to protect users from potential threats. The Redmi Note 8 Pro also includes features like a fingerprint sensor and face unlock, which provide convenient and secure ways to unlock the device. The fingerprint sensor is located on the rear of the phone, while the face unlock feature uses the front-facing camera to recognize the user’s face. The Importance of Screen Resolution and Pixel Density
Screen resolution and pixel density are critical factors in determining the visual quality of a smartphone display. The screen resolution refers to the number of pixels that make up the display, while the pixel density (measured in pixels per inch or PPI) indicates how closely packed those pixels are. A higher resolution and pixel density result in sharper, more detailed images and text.
For designers and developers, the screen resolution is particularly important because it determines the breakpoints and media queries used to create responsive websites and applications. Media queries allow developers to tailor the layout and design of their websites to different screen sizes and resolutions, ensuring that they look good on all devices. Understanding the screen resolution of popular devices like the Redmi Note 8 Pro is essential for creating a seamless user experience. Pixel density also plays a role in visual quality. A higher pixel density means that the pixels are more closely packed together, making it harder to distinguish individual pixels with the naked eye. This results in a smoother, more realistic image. Devices with lower pixel densities may exhibit a “screen door effect,” where the individual pixels are visible, detracting from the overall viewing experience.
